How much do full time remote creative director j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 31, 2026, the average yearly pay for full time remote creative director in the United States is $120,057.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$87,500.00 and $149,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Full Time Remote Creative Director vs Full Time Remote Graphic Designer?

AspectFull Time Remote Creative DirectorFull Time Remote Graphic Designer
Required CredentialsPortfolio, Bachelor's in Design or related field, leadership skillsPortfolio, Bachelor's in Graphic Design or related field
Work EnvironmentLeads creative teams, strategic planning, client interactionExecutes design projects, creates visual content, collaborates with teams
Industry UsageAdvertising, branding, media agencies, large corporations

The main difference is that a Full Time Remote Creative Director oversees creative teams and strategic projects, while a Full Time Remote Graphic Designer focuses on executing visual designs. Both roles require strong portfolios and design credentials, but the Creative Director has additional leadership and strategic responsibilities.

The Role
This is a senior individual contributor role with a Creative Director title. You won't have direct reports on day one. You will own the creative output of the agency across brand strategy, design, copywriting, and video and motion work. You'll work directly with the Marketing Director and Account Director as a three-person leadership core, shaping the thinking behind every engagement and executing it at the level our clients expect.
The right person for this role wants the autonomy and ownership of a senior IC and is excited to grow into a leadership position as we hire creative talent under them. You'll set the bar, define the standards, and build the foundation a team will eventually scale on top of.
What You'll Own
Design. This is the primary need. Visual identity systems, campaign creative, web design partnership with our digital team, sales and marketing collateral, and pitch materials. You set the visual standard for everything that leaves the agency, and your hands are on the work.
Brand strategy. Positioning, messaging architecture, voice and tone, audience and persona development, naming, and the strategic briefs that drive every creative engagement. You'll work directly with our Differentiator Framework and help operationalize it for client work.
Copywriting. Brand messaging, web copy, campaign copy, sales narratives, and long-form content. You can write across registers, from a punchy headline to a thoughtful executive narrative.
Video and motion. You don't need to be a full-time editor or animator, but you should be able to direct video work, write scripts, storyboard concepts, and partner with production resources to deliver finished motion work.
Creative leadership. You'll be the creative voice in client conversations, internal strategy sessions, and new business pitches. You'll define how Plan Left's creative work shows up in the market.
Who You Are
You're a strong designer first. You've spent at least eight years honing your craft, with meaningful time as a senior designer, art director, associate creative director, or creative director. Your portfolio shows range and depth across brand identity, digital, and campaign work. Design is what got you here, and it's still where you do your best thinking.
You can also write. Plan Left's positioning lives or dies on language, and you don't need a copywriter to draft a headline, a tagline, or a clean piece of web copy. You won't always be the final word on copy, but you can hold your own.
You think in systems. You're as comfortable building a brand identity system as you are designing a landing page or directing a campaign. You believe the brief is where great work starts, and you push back when one is weak.
You have taste, opinions, and the ability to defend both. You can present work to a skeptical client and bring them along without compromising the idea.
You're a self-starter who thrives in remote work. You manage your own time, communicate proactively, and don't need to be in a room to do your best thinking.
